 IMPORTANT REMARKS

•  Please read the instruction carefully before installation
•  Follow all instructions, since incorrect installation can lead to 

severe injury

•  The installation must be done by a technician following the 

safety norms in force

•  Only apply to authorized personnel to replace the feeding 

cable of the motor

•  Do not pierce nor insert screws in the whole length of the 

motor

•  Avoid any contact of the motor with liquids
•  Avoid to crush or knock over the motor
•  Possible tampering or wrong connections are not covered by 

guarantee

  If a manual release is provided, the actuating member is to be 

installed at a height less than 1,8m

  Before installing the drive, remove any unnecessary cords and 

disable any equipment not needed for powered operation.

  For installation for awnings, a horizontal distance of at least 

0,4 m is to be maintained between the fully unrolled driven 
part and any permanent object

  The power supply cable should not be exposed to sunlight or 

rain directly

  Assure that all accessories have been fixed so that the motor 

works without any mechanical problem. The loading weight 
should be matched with the output power of the motor

  Electrical connection must be done by professional technicians 

to operate in conformity with the rules

•  Do not allow children to play with fixed controls
•  Keeps remote controls away from children
•  Frequently examine the installation for imbalance and sings of 

wear or damage to cables and springs

•  Do not use if repair or adjustment is necessary
•  Moving parts of the drive must be installed higher than 2.5 m 

above the floor or other level that could provide access to it

•  The actuating member of a biased-off switch is to be located 

within direct sight of the driven part but away from moving 
parts. It is to be installed at a minimum height of 1.5 m

•  Fixed controls have to be installed visibly
•  The appliance can not be used in outside

ELECTRIC CONNECTIONS

•  Operators must be installed with a bipolar switch with a 

minimum contact clearance opening distance of at least 3mm 
(fig.3).

•  Do not connect more than one motor for every push-button 

of command.

•  Reverse the brown and black cables, in order to change the 

direction of revolution (fig.3)

LIMIT SWITCH ADJUSTMENT

•  The limit switches system is electromechanical and through a 

micro-switch it interrupts the feeding of the motor when the 
roller shutter or the awning reaches the limit of opening and 
closing. 

•  The limit switches are pre-adjusted to approximately 5 crown 

revolutions. 

•  To adjust the opening and closing limit is necessary to turn the 

adjusting screw placed on the head of the motor through the 
plastic screwdriver included in the box (fig.4). 

•  Feed the motor and observe the sense of rotation of the pulley 

and/or of the crown ; turn the adjusting screw towards (+) 
to increase the speed of the motor, turn the adjusting screw 
towards (-) to decrease it (fig.4). 

•  Reverse the direction of revolution of the motor and operate 

on the second limit switch (fig.4).

•  In case that the motor is powered and it doesn’t move in 

any direction (or one of the two directions), then is possible 
the limit switches are pressed. In that case, use the plastic 
screwdriver to turn the corresponding adjustment screws on 
the head of the motor, turning them towards the + (clockwise) 
several times to give it more race.
